Decatur, the second oldest city in the metro Atlanta area, has deep roots in the past. The city began as a small trading area and was named for Stephen Decatur, a US Naval hero. Ironically, the city of Decatur passed up an opportunity to become a major stopping point on a prominent railroad line. The railroad moved its stopping point several miles south and the city of Atlanta was born. Decatur never missed the success of its younger sibling. Located only a few miles from Atlanta, the city of Decatur offers residents an incredibly quick commute to the business hub of the South, as well as access to the city's own businesses and shops. The best example of this is found in the city's population. With a permanent population of only 18,000, the city swells to accommodate over 24,000 people each and every day. These are people who commute to Decatur for the incredible business opportunities the city offers. Decatur is an amazing place for many things, including raising a family and building a business.
